Assuming you have the right skills, attitude, experience, and patience to tutor other students, you have found a great opportunity to purposely hone your skills, earn some profit, and help other students who, like we all, have a particular set of needs and are seeking your help, a very honorable and humbling position to be in.
Some quick thoughts I have having tutored in college in a variety of subjects myself:
- Online platforms for tutoring like this one are a great place to start and market yourself in this desired position.
- Reach out to the tutoring services office at your college to learn about the specific procedure to become a tutor there.
- Contact the tutoring office at your high school or nearby ones to offer your services.
- Open an Instagram and/or LinkedIn professional page to present yourself, follow other people with similar jobs and share content related to the services you are offering.
